Effectiveness of Construction and Demolition Wastes on Mechanical Characteristics of M-30 Grade Concrete

Ghanshyam Gupta, Rajneesh Sharma, Rajdeep Dwivedi, Dr. Chayan Gupta

Abstract


The industrialization production rate increases the disposal demand of waste materials. The land disposal method for disposing the waste materials is one of the conventional methods requires a large area of land, but now a days due to lack of land availability these waste materials used as a construction material in various civil engineering applications.In recent years, Construction and Demolition Wastes (CDW) are increasing day by day and these are the wastes which influence our natural environment. To reduce the impact of these types of wastes, a study was conducted in laboratory and targeted to attain sustainability by reusing waste demolished concrete or recycled aggregates up to the optimum use. For examine the efficiency by RA, different percentage of RA replace with natural aggregate (0%, 20%, 40%, 50%, 60%, 80%, 100%) and evaluated the compressive strength of concrete cubes at 7and 28 days.
